Stations Of the Cross

Today we started coloring our Stations of the Cross book. Each child will color a page for each station and at the end we will make a book out of our coloring pages. I've have the images for a year or two so i don't know where I got them from but if you just google "Stations of the Cross coloring" you should find something suitable.

After the kids colored the 1st station (well mommy colored one for V since he was napping)
I had the kids cut out their pages and glue them onto construction paper.
